The sport industry and employment opportunities in the industry continue to expand throughout the world. However, alongside this growth there has also developed a more competitive labour market and higher expectations of organisations, managers and customers within the sport industry.
The MA/MSc in Sport Business Management aims to provide specialist training for individuals working in sport or those seeking a professional management career in the sport industry.

Your future Graduates of the MA/MSc in Sport Business Management will gain competencies in the application of management concepts, techniques and strategies for the solution of real life problems and issues in sport management
Students who wish to build their competencies in business skills such as finance, economics and statistical analysis may opt for the MSc route. For applicants who prefer to develop their training and skills in marketing and human resource management, for example, the MA route offers a more appropriate choice.
Students on the MA/MSc Sport Business Management programme will be required to successfully complete the following subject areas over three semesters. Students will also be expected to undertake a sport dissertation or company internship report*.
Mandatory areas of study for the MA/MSc in Sport Business Management:
* Sports Industry and Markets
* Sport Marketing and Sponsorship
* Sport Operations Management
* Directed Readings in Sport Management
* Sports Law and Broadcasting
* Events Management
Optional subject choices for MA in Sport Business Management available for students include:
* Strategic Management
* Human Resource Management
* Consumer Behaviour
* Managing Small Businesses
* Applied Management Skills
* Consultancy and Research Management
Optional subject choices for MSc in Sport Business Management available for students include:
* Financial Decision Making
* Corporate Financial Management
* Financial Statement Analysis
* Statistics for Management
* Economic Development
* International Strategic Management

The internship programme
As part of the Sport Business Management MA/MSc degree students have the option of enrolling on the internship programme.
This module normally lasts between 8-12 weeks and provides students with an opportunity to undertake a workplace project on behalf of an organisation.
Coventry University Business School works closely with companies across the UK and Europe to offer a wide variety of internships.
Eligibility
Students must successfully meet the following assessment criteria:
* Academic - successful completion of all Semester 1 modules including research methods at the first attempt
* CV Short listing - Submit a CV, which will be used for competitive short listing by the internship panel.
* Presentation - prepare and successfully deliver a formal presentation
* Interview- interview with the university internship panel
Assessment
After completing the Internship, you are required to write an extensive report based on the managerial and educational experience derived from the internship itself and present your findings to both the employers and academic staff.

Register Now!Applicants will normally hold a good honours degree in a relevant academic discipline. Applications from candidates with relevant experience will be considered on an individual basis.
The course is conducted in English and so those applicants whose first language is not English are normally required to hold IELTS 6.5 or equivalent. Coventry University also has an English Academy(CUEA) which runs specialist English courses of 5, 10 and 15 weeks.
